DARC (DAta Radio Channel), an FM multiplex broadcast technology, has been
developed by NHK (Japan Broadcasting Corporation). DARC is a registered
trademark of NHK Engineering Service (NHK-ES).
Any manufacturer licensed by NHK-ES can manufacture and sell products that
utilize the DARC technology. The products utilizing the DARC technology can
be marked with the logotype shown to the left.
In the DARC system, 16kbps of digital data L-MSK modulated at 76KHz are
multiplied on an ordinary FM broadcast base band signal.
An FM multiplex demodulation LSI performs decoding of the digital data
signal.
